what is service tax, how much calculated on service?

Service Tax is a form of indirect tax imposed on specified
services called "taxable services". Service tax cannot be
levied on any service which is not included in the list of
taxable services. The objective behind levying service tax
is to reduce the degree of intensity of taxation on
manufacturing and trade without forcing the government to
compromise on the revenue needs.
calculation:
On February 24, 2009 in order to give relief to the
industry reeling under the impact of economic recession,
the rate of Service Tax was reduced from 12 percent to 10
percent. Effective Service Tax in India now stands at 10.3%.
